No poster

Overlords of the U.F.O.

Overlords of the U.F.O.

Release: 1977-11-05·Runtime: 94m·★ 2.7
纪录

No overview available.

Production Countries

United States of America

Production Companies

Tower Investments International Ltd.
Scientific News

Crew